Embodiment 1

[0044] see figure 1 and figure 2 , the present embodiment provides a distributed self-service library management system, and its management system includes:

[0045] The book lending terminal is used to self-obtain and record member readers and staff information, and send member readers related borrowing, return, purchase requests, and staff operation requests. There are multiple book lending terminals that can be configured in different geographical regions. Each The book lending terminal is equipped with at least one cabinet for providing book placement space;

Embodiment 2

[0056] On the basis of Embodiment 1, its book lending terminal is configured with:

[0057] The identification module is used to enter and identify the information of members, readers and staff. The identification module has paths for face recognition login, registration password login, and network authorization login. Face recognition login can identify the serial number of the face sdk;

[0058] RFID module for reading and identifying / loading book ID tags or book ISBN codes;

[0059] The display module is connected with the identification module and the RFID module, and is used to display the information of member readers and staff members and their operation information on the screen, display related description information of books, and provide operation pages for member readers and staff members; the related description information of books includes books and books Location, quantity, category, real-time location; the display module can choose a touch screen;

Abstract

The invention relates to a distributed self-service library management system and method, the system comprises book borrowing ends, a management end, a database and the Internet of Things, a plurality of book borrowing ends can be configured and distributed in different geographic areas, and each book borrowing end is configured with at least one cabinet for providing book placement space; the management end positions and is in butt joint with geographic positions of the book borrowing ends, receives and gathers data information of the book borrowing ends, and controls operation management of the book borrowing ends by sending instructions; the database is in electrical communication connection with the management end; and the Internet of Things is respectively coupled with the management end and the plurality of book borrowing ends in a communication manner. The system meets the requirements of member readers for books, can effectively promote and optimize book resource allocation and system operation management capability, expands time and space for public service in an all-weather self-service mode, and has the advantages of high efficiency and low cost.
